Speaking of the Netherlands, tulips, wooden tracks and windmills blurted out, while the children's dike is the most reserved place for large windmills in the Netherlands. The Netherlands is the lowest landed country in the world. In ancient times, it used to build dams and drain out of windmills, and the windmills also did some grinding work. Now of course, it will not use windmills to drain, but as the "national essence" of the Netherlands, and open sightseeing as a scenic spot.
